Abstract
In cognitive semantics, a polysemous word constitutes a semantic concept, and the various meanings of that word assign themselves to radial network members of that concept. Accordingly, this study investigates the polysemy of the prefix "/pas-/" based on a cognitive semantic approach. The nature of this qualitative research is descriptive-analytical, and data have been extracted from Persian-language resources, namely Dehkhoda Dictionary (1994), Moein Dictionary (2003), and Amid Dictionary (2010), using a library research method. In this study, the two criteria of Tylor and Evans (2003), namely the prototypical fixed meaning or historically evidenced meaning and salience and prominence in the semantic network, have been employed to determine the primary or prototype meaning of Persian language prefixes. The authors aim to demonstrate that the prefix "/pas-/" is a polysemous prefix with a spectrum of lexical functions. This prefix, given its usage in Persian, has different semantic clusters such as "after, before, in front, back, and behind," which have expanded from a prototype or primary meaning. The findings indicated that the prefix "/pas-/" attaches to diverse textual foundations and generates newly derived words such as "pas-farda (the day after tomorrow), pas-pariirooz (the day before yesterday), pas-andaz (savings), pas-larze (aftershock)," and the like. It is observed that the prefix "/pas-/" possesses an extensive radial network due to the combination of this prefix with various verbs.

Volume 0, Issue 0 (Articles accepted at the time of publication 2024)
Abstract
Explaining the nature of metaphor and its role in language has always been a controversial topic in the fields of linguistics, philosophy of language, rhetoric, and so forth. In metaphor analysis, these fields often converge in an inseparable manner. Donald Davidson, a 20th-century philosopher, is one of the influential theorists in the Philosophy of Language and the Theory of Meaning. His views on the essence and role of metaphor in language bear significant similarities to the ideas of al-Jurjani, a prominent 5th-century Hijri literary scholar. This research aims, through a descriptive-analytical method and a comparative approach, to examine the intersection points of Davidson’s and al-Jurjani’s theories, with one addressing metaphor from a philosophical and linguistic perspective and the other from a rhetorical standpoint. For this purpose, Davidson’s essay "What Metaphors Mean?" is used as the basis for reviewing his theories on metaphor. Al-Jurjani’s views are analyzed with a focus on "Dala'il al-I'jaz." This study yields results in three areas. The first, identifies similar aspects in the two theories, indicating that both theorists reject the idea of metaphor being merely a shortened simile. They also critique the notion of "metaphorical meaning," emphasizing that the meaning of a metaphor cannot be reproduced in any form other than the metaphorical one itself. The second area involves finding complementary aspects in the two theories, considering Davidson's philosophical stance and al-Jurjani's rhetorical position. The third area elaborates on the connection between al-Jurjani's direct views on metaphor and the ideas indirectly inferred from theory of Construction.

Volume 0, Issue 0 (ARTICLES IN PRESS 2024)
Abstract
This study investigated the effects of irrigation strategies including sustained deficit irrigation (SDI) and partial root-zone drying (PRD) on the growth, physiology, and photosynthesis of strawberry plants in order to maximize crop productivity while maintaining water resources. This experiment has four irrigation strategies (FI: control (full irrigation volume), PRD1 (full irrigation volume), PRD2 (50% of FI), and SDI (50% of FI) and two fertilizer strengths (EC1 and EC2) with four replicates per treatment. Gas exchange, leaf chlorophyll index, stomatal conductance (gs), and maximum quantum efficiency of PSII photochemistry (F'v/F'm) were assessed on three occasions throughout the experimental duration in order to monitor the impact of different irrigation strategies on photosynthesis. Yield water use efficiency, as well as TSS (total soluble solids) and TA (total titratable acidity), two fruit quality-related parameters, were also measured. In the final stage, PRD2-EC2 photosystem II efficiency was 9% higher than SDI-EC2. Also, the PRD strategy effectively influenced and regulated the adjustment of stomatal conductance (gs). In diluted fertilizer (EC2), yield WUE of PRD1 and SDI performed 15% and 30.7% lower than FI-EC2. However, PRD2-EC2 treatment increased 72.5% more than the control. Our observations of leaf and fruit deficiencies showed that the PRD strategy had long-term benefits for the plant and reduced water consumption. However, to establish a sustainable irrigation strategy, the nutrient solution must be adjusted to control growth and photosynthesis attributes.

Volume 0, Issue 0 (ARTICLES IN PRESS 2024)
Abstract
Various factors, such as temperature stress, dietary changes, and the entry of contaminants and infections into the hemolymph, are known to affect insect immune responses by altering hemocyte profiles. The research focused on the hemocyte profile, hemogram across all biological stages, and the morphological and frequency changes of hemocytes in third instar larvae exposed to temperature stress. Cucumber fruits infected with insect larvae were collected and brought to the laboratory, where third instar larvae were extracted from the fruit tissue. The hemolymph was then collected, and after staining with Giemsa solution, hemocytes were identified under a light microscope. The hemogram analysis included measurements of DHC, THC, blood volume, and AHC across all biological stages. In third instar larvae, plasmatocytes and granulocytes were the most abundant, comprising about 56% of the hemocyte population. In contrast, prohemocytes were most frequent in the first instar larvae, accounting for approximately 37%. THC was highest in third instar larvae, indicating a direct correlation between hemolymph volume and total hemocyte count. Temperature stress had a significant impact on hemocyte numbers. Heat stress, with temperatures up to 30 and 35 °C, led to a notable increase in total cell count, granulocytes, and plasmatocytes. Conversely, cold temperatures resulted in a decrease in prohemocytes, plasmatocytes, granulocytes, and the total cell count compared to the control group. Additionally, temperature stress induced hemocyte deformation, with plasmatocytes and granulocytes showing the most pronounced changes under heat stress, including torn cell walls and loss of cell contents at 35 ○C.

Volume 0, Issue 0 (ARTICLES IN PRESS 2024)
Abstract
Due to their antimicrobial and antioxidant properties, essential oils are used as natural preservatives. The purpose of this study was to investigate the chemical composition, antioxidant properties, and antimicrobial activity of emulsion and nanoemulsion forms of Salvia officinalis, Pimpinella anisum, Dracocephalum moldavica, and Syzygium aromaticum essential oils. The Agar well-diffusion assay results obtained from the experiment suggested that nanoemulsion of Dracocephalum moldavica essential oil had the maximum antimicrobial activity against the pathogenic microorganisms drawn in the experiment. The inhibition zone diameters of the nanoemulsion of this essential oil against Shigella dysenteriae, Salmonella Typhimurium, Pseudomonas aeruginosa, Staphylococcus aureus, Listeria monocytogenes, Escherichia coli, and Bacillus cereus were 11.03, 11.82, 13.02, 13.13, 13.13, 13.62, and 14.10 mm, respectively. In contrast, the inhibition zone diameters of the emulsion form of this essential oil against S. dysenteriae, S. Typhimurium, P. aeruginosa, S. aureus, L. monocytogenes, E. coli, and B. cereus were 9.66, 10.34, 10.84, 11.84, 11.34, 11.17, and 11.24 mm, respectively. The major components of Dracocephalum moldavica essential oil included geraniol (27.24%), geranial (10.75%), alpha-copaene (8.16%), alpha-pinene (7.37%), carvacrol (7.41%), limonene (6.86%), and nerol (6.45%). The nanoemulsion form of the essential oils investigated thus possessed a significantly greater antioxidant potential compared to their emulsion form. This study also demonstrated that the nanoemulsions exhibited significantly lower IC50 values compared to the emulsions. From the results, it was seen that the nanoemulsion form of Dracocephalum moldavica essential oil had the lowest IC50 and EC50 values of 22.17 µg/ml and 4.51 µg/ml, respectively.
Volume 0, Issue 0 (ARTICLES IN PRESS 2024)
Abstract
This study examines changes in hemocyte profiles and phenoloxidase activity in larvae of Tuta absoluta Meyrick (Lepidoptera: Gelechiidae) under conditions of starvation, dietary variation, and thermal stress in laboratory settings. T. absoluta-infected tomato fruits were collected from fields and transported to laboratory, where larvae were extracted from fruits after two generations of rearing, Hemolymph was extracted with a capillary tube and placed on a slide. Hemocytes were identified through Giemsa staining and observed under light microscopy at 40× magnification. Starvation stress was induced for 12 and 24 hours while the control group remained unstressed. Hemocyte counts were determined using a hemocytometer under light microscopy at 40× magnification. Starved larvae exhibited significantly reduced total hemocyte counts, plasmatocytes, and granulocytes compared to the control group. Larvae reared on eight tomato varieties (Superchef, Basimo, Hartiva, Berantta, Breivio, Gs15, 1012, and 8320) displayed variable hemocyte densities, with the highest counts observed in those fed on Superchef and Gs15 cultivars. For thermal stress experiments, third- and fourth-instar larvae were exposed to 28°C and 4°C for 12 and 24 hours. Control groups for third and fourth instar larvae maintained at 25 ± 1°C. In total hemocyte and granulocyte densities were significantly reduced across all thermal treatments compared to controls. Plasmatocyte counts in third-instar larvae subjected to 12 hours of heat stress (327.5±18 cell/mm3 hemolymph) and cold stress (320±34.3 cell/mm3 hemolymph) were higher than those in control (294.3±23.3 cell/mm3 hemolymph). Phenoloxidase activity exhibited a direct correlation with hemocyte alterations across all experimental conditions. This study provides a foundation for further investigations into the pest's physiological defense mechanisms.
Volume 0, Issue 0 (Articles accepted for Publication 2024)
Abstract
Aim and Introduction
Achieving sustained and long-term economic growth necessitates the optimal allocation and utilization of resources at the national level. This goal relies heavily on the existence of efficient financial markets, particularly well-functioning and extensive capital markets. Numerous macroeconomic variables can influence the level of risk associated with shareholder rights, corporate cash flows, and adjusted discount rates. Additionally, changes in economic conditions can alter both the quantity and nature of investment opportunities.
However, establishing a fixed and consistent relationship between macroeconomic variables and stock price indices remains challenging. The complex and dynamic nature of financial markets makes it difficult to identify a method that accurately reflects economic conditions and captures the most critical influencing variables. Therefore, this study employs machine learning models to identify the key macroeconomic factors affecting stock price indices.
Methodology
Feature selection is one of the most common and crucial techniques in data preprocessing and serves as an essential component of machine learning. This study employs feature selection models to identify the most relevant predictors of the stock price index. The models utilized include the random forest method and regularized linear regression. To examine the nature of the relationships between variables, the jointness method was applied. Additionally, the mutual information analysis was conducted to assess the influence of key variables over different decades, enabling a deeper understanding of how the impact of macroeconomic factors on stock prices has evolved over time.
Findings
The study analyzed the impact of selected macroeconomic variables on stock price indices, focusing on the Tehran Stock Exchange. The findings from the Random Forest (RF) and Regularized Linear Regression (RLR) models indicate that exchange rates, financial development, inflation, economic growth, trade openness, and global uncertainty significantly influence Iran’s stock price index. The results demonstrate that global uncertainty, interest rates, and trade openness exert negative effects on stock prices, whereas the other variables positively influence stock prices.
The jointness method was employed to analyze the relationships between these variables, further confirming their significance. Moreover, the Mutual Information method was used to examine how the influence of these key variables varied across different decades.
Discussion and Conclusion
Among the variables examined, exchange rates, financial development, inflation, economic growth, trade openness, and global uncertainty emerged as the most significant factors influencing Iran’s stock price index. This finding is not surprising, given Iran’s historical experience with significant exchange rate fluctuations and persistent inflationary pressures. Global uncertainty has consistently influenced domestic markets in Iran due to political and economic instability. Previous research has highlighted the complex relationship between exchange rate fluctuations and stock price indices (Ratanapakorn & Sharma, 2007). Scholars have argued that the relationship between stock prices and exchange rates can significantly affect monetary and fiscal policy, as a recessionary stock market can reduce overall demand and impact broader economic performance.
Extensive research has also investigated the relationship between inflation and stock prices, identifying inflation as a significant factor affecting stock indices
(Boudoukh & Richardson, 1993; Fama & Schwert, 1977; Jaffe & Mandelker, 1976) . While some studies have reported a positive correlation between inflation and stock prices, others have found a negative relationship.
Moreover, trade openness has been recognized as a key factor influencing stock market fluctuations. Open economies are more vulnerable to external shocks due to increased global risk-sharing among markets. Although some studies have not found conclusive evidence of a direct effect between trade openness and stock prices, trade openness remains one of the influential factors (Nickmansh, 2016).
Stock prices reflect the present value of future cash flows, which are subject to two main effects: cash flow changes driven by increased production and interest rates, which serve as a discount factor. Stock prices tend to decline when expected cash flows decrease or interest rates rise. The level of actual economic activity directly influences cash flows, as higher economic activity generally leads to increased cash flow. Among the various indicators used to predict commodity markets, real Gross Domestic Product (GDP) is considered the most comprehensive measure of economic activity (Yuhasin, 2011; Christopher et al., 2006).

Volume 1, Issue 1 (1-2013)
Abstract
In many of mythical, folklore and fairy stories, the birth of the hero has many mythical and fictional characteristics. The grounding of the birth of the hero traces on the hero’s future life. In many stories, which have the birth function, there are many barriers in the birth process. Among these obstacles, we can name aging parents and their disability to have a child.
The remarkable point in this story is that the child, despite many barriers, is born, and after a dangerous and wonderful life, becomes a hero. The main goal of this article is the psychological analysis and classification of the type of tales.
This research investigates the birth of the hero as a current theme in mythical, folklore and fairy stories, and its conclusion shows that we can classify the different types of birth function in the following groups as: the birth without parent origin, the birth process with one origin (father or mother), the marriage of the king with particular girl (sometimes a fairy), and the birth of the hero in the aging parent time and eating apple condition for mother.
Volume 1, Issue 1 (4-2014)
Abstract
Background and Objectives:HBV and HTLV-I are life threatening infectious agents in patients who receive blood and blood products. Although serological methods have been proved to be useful, detection of these viruses has remained a challengingissue due to the many obstacles. By the advent of Nucleic Acid Testing methods, especially in multiplex format, more precise detection is possible.The objective of this study was to develop a reliable, rapid and cost- effective method tosimultaneously detect HBV and HTLV-I. Materials and Methods: We have developed a multiplex Real time-PCR assay for simultaneous detection of HBV and HTLV-I. Primer sets were designed for highly conserved regions of genome of each virus. Using these primers and standard plasmids, we determined the limit of detection, clinical and analytical specificity and sensitivity of the assay. Monoplex and multiplex Real-time PCRs were performed. Results: Analytical sensitivity was considered to be 1000 and 100 copies/ml for HBV and HTLV-I, respectively. High concentration of one virus had no adverse effect on detection of t low concentrations of the other one. By analyzing 30 samples, clinical sensitivity of the assay was determined to be 87% and 96% for HBV and HTLV-I, respectively. Using different viral and human genome samples, the specificity of the assay was verified to be 100%. Conclusions:We have developed a reliable, rapid and cost effective method tosimultaneously detect HBV and HTLV-I.Our results indicatedthe high capability of this simple and rapid method for detecting these viruses in clinical samples.
